HONG KONG, Aug. 18, 2026 /PRNewswire/ -- Sponsored by CTF Life and fully supported by the Chow Tai Fook Charity Foundation, "CTF Life 40th Anniversary Presents: Growing Up Together – Hong Kong's Giant Panda Twins Birthday Celebration" was held successfully at Ocean Park Hong Kong on Saturday (15 August) to commemorate the second birthday of Hong Kong's first locally born giant panda twins, Jia Jia and De De.
The event welcomed around 1,000 participants who enjoyed a special screening of Hong Kong's first giant panda documentary, From 100 grams, followed by a fun day out at Ocean Park. Among them were 500 children and family members from grassroots communities supported by nine local NGOs. They were joined by CTF Life customers, Life Planners, CTF Life ‧ CIRCLE members and employees. United and inspired by the story of the giant panda twins, they spent the day learning, discovering and connecting with one another while marking a meaningful milestone that speaks to the power of care, perseverance and growth.
A key initiative in CTF Life's 40th anniversary celebrations, the event reflects the Company's deep roots in Hong Kong and its commitment to growing alongside the community it has served for four decades. Through its partnership with Ocean Park and the Chow Tai Fook Charity Foundation, the programme combined life education, ecological conservation and community engagement. Nine beneficiary organisations were involved: the Society for Community Organization, J Life Foundation, Concern for Grassroots' Livelihood Alliance, Hong Kong Christian Shuen Tao Church (Mongkok), Kwun Tong Methodist Social Service, People Service Centre, Hong Kong Women Workers' Association, Hong Kong Christian Shuen Tao Church (Sheung Shui) and Urban Peacemaker. One of the day's highlights was a special preview screening of From 100 grams, Hong Kong's first giant panda documentary, at Ocean Park's Applause Pavilion. Directed by Benny Lau, the film chronicles the extraordinary early days and months of Jia Jia and De De – capturing the challenges, milestones and heartwarming moments that have shaped their journey since birth. The documentary has already drawn international attention at the Cannes Film Festival, attracting interest from overseas distributors, and is set to feature at several international film festivals later this year, bringing Hong Kong's conservation story to audiences worldwide.

1. Macro Strategy Panel: Navigating Fed Policy and the Disinflationary AI Wave
A flagship highlight of this year's festival occurred on August 18, when GTJAI Chief Economist Zhou Hao hosted an in-depth macro strategy panel alongside Ding Yifei, Head of Asset Management at GTJAI, and Dr. Wang Shengzu, Head of Asset Management at Haitong International. The panel analysed Federal Reserve monetary policy trajectories, global capital flows, and cross-asset allocation strategies for the second half of 2026.
The expert panel reached a clear consensus that the probability of further interest rate hikes by the Federal Reserve in the second half of the year remains exceptionally low. Addressing market concerns regarding artificial intelligence and inflation, the panellists noted that while massive capital expenditure driven by the AI boom creates near-term upward pressure on prices, the structural impact over a longer horizon tells a different story. Over time, AI integration will substantially enhance total factor productivity across industries, ultimately acting as a powerful disinflationary force for the global economy.
In fixed income markets, Dr. Wang Shengzu projected a stabilising-to-declining trajectory for 10-year US Treasury yields throughout H2, elevating the tactical appeal of high-quality financial bonds. Recognising supply-side pressures on longer-duration US Treasuries, Ding Yifei advised conservative investors to overweight short-to-medium-duration, high-grade credit as well as emerging market investment-grade bonds with maturities under three years to lock in historically attractive yields with high certainty.
Regarding global equities, Dr. Wang maintained a long-term optimistic outlook on US technology equities, supported by resilient corporate balance sheets, steady earnings growth, and favourable structural tailwinds. He recommended that investors adopt a "Stay Invested" strategy to navigate short-term macroeconomic noise and market volatility. Turning to Hong Kong equities, Ding pointed out that valuations remain at historic lows relative to major global benchmarks. This presents compelling entry opportunities for long-term investors seeking high-dividend yield targets alongside market-leading technology enterprises.
Beyond his positive stance on Hong Kong equities, Ding further recommended incorporating a strategic allocation of 5% to 10% in gold-related assets to enhance portfolio resilience and act as an inflation hedge within a diversified multi-asset framework.
2. Dual-Hub Synergy: Unlocking Hong Kong and Singapore Advantages
As part of GTJAI's commitment to expanding its international wealth management footprint, the Company collaborated closely with its Singapore subsidiary to host a dedicated strategic forum. Li Xuan, Head of Wealth Management at GTJAI Singapore, and Liu Xin, Head of Asset Management at GTJAI Singapore, explored the complementary attributes of Hong Kong and Singapore as Asia's premier wealth management centres.
Li Xuan underscored Hong Kong's irreplaceable position as the primary bridge connecting Chinese Mainland's deep liquidity pools with global financial markets. Hong Kong excels in offering deep liquidity within the offshore RMB ecosystem, access to standardised financial instruments, and direct investment links into Chinese Mainland. Conversely, Singapore has solidified its reputation as a leading global asset allocation hub and safe haven, distinguishing itself through multi-regional asset diversification, cross-border corporate structuring, family office administration, and alternative asset structuring. Li emphasised that sophisticated investors should view accounts across both jurisdictions not as isolated pools, but as a unified, dual-hub framework—leveraging Hong Kong for China-focused market opportunities and Singapore for global risk dispersion.
Addressing the broader economic backdrop characterised by persistent inflation, market volatility, and selective growth opportunities, Liu Xin noted that fixed-income yields remain near two-to-three-decade highs. He favoured short-duration (under three years) emerging market investment-grade bonds and short-term US Treasuries to capture solid income. On the equity side, AI-driven structural growth remains a key conviction theme. To further enhance portfolio resilience, Liu suggested allocating 10% to 20% across gold and commodities as alternative asset hedges. Furthermore, he highlighted that establishing robust trust structures and family office frameworks in Singapore provides an effective layer of risk isolation between enterprise operational liabilities and private family wealth.
